2013 Subaru Outback engine swap

Asked by Robbie Jul 02, 2018 at 08:10 AM about the 2013 Subaru Outback 2.5i

Question type: Maintenance & Repair

I have a 2013 6 speed manual that burns a lot of oil, I'm planning to replace
with a good used motor, The Hollander interchange list the engine for the CVT
Trans and the Manual as different/incompatible. Does anyone know the
difference? I can buy a used engine from a cvt car for 1/2 the price of a manual

No you cant, can't even swap sti with a wrx because the trans is geared differently, a lot of people complain about the difference but Subarus are very trans sensitive tires have to be within 1/4 inch circumference of each other or you'll ruin your trans that's why if you pop 1 tire depending on the others tread life you need to replace them all and no one like hearing that, they are great vehicles just have they're own set of bs like any other manufacturer

What is the difference? Same 2.5 motor! is it bell housing, Flywheel, HP. I understand the WRX/STI as they are pretty different but this seem's to be the same motor with the CVT/Manual being the only difference
